The primary season of the favored platform fighter MultiVersus has been delayed previous its unique August 9 launch date, and there isn’t any phrase but on when it can really launch. The official MultiVersus Twitter account made the announcement, providing no clear purpose for the delay. Since a playable Morty was promised for the season premiere, that new playable character can be delayed.
“We need to let everybody know that we’re delaying the beginning of Season 1 and the discharge of Morty to a later date,” the account tweeted. “We all know this may be disappointing for some and need to guarantee our group that we’re devoted to delivering new and thrilling content material that delights gamers.
“We’ll let you already know the timing as quickly as we will. We respect your persistence and enthusiasm and look ahead to unveiling season 1 very quickly!”
